Im looking for a nice backup reel, and ive seen the Abu Garcia Silver Max, but i havn't found any reviews on it. Can anyone tell me if they've had any expirience with it?

Posted

I have a few, basically field testing them.

They have the feel of a Revo on the rod.

They cast a mile.

They also feel like they're made of plastic when reeling in with or without a fish on the end.  Perhaps because I have so many other Revo's on other rods but you can feel the reel isn't as solid.

Not that that's a bad thing, shoot, for around $40 -45 (going price on Ebay), it's hard to beat.  As to the long term reliability?

i have the black max and the pro max, which sandwich the silver max in the 'max' lineup. i originally bought both as backups.

i agree with j-zink's assessment. for whatever reason, they cast a country mile (at least 20% more distance than i can get with my revo S's, don't ask me why). but, they're only okay for smoothness and so-so feeling in terms of solidness. but, hey, great value for the price.
